Choose language

Online English Teachers

Chosen by 500,000 caring parents worldwide.

Private English tutoring with the best native-speaking teachers for kids 4-12

feature icon100% professional teachers
feature iconInteractive classroom
feature iconLearning through play
hero image
Gender
arrow bottom
Specialty
arrow bottom
Accent
arrow bottom
Country
arrow bottom
Level of English
arrow bottom
teacher avatar

Sinazo

map markerSouth Africa
user languageNative speaker
thumb up496 positive feedbacks
students37 active students
lessons6779 lessons
Sorry, the teacher doesn't have free slots. Please choose another
Sorry, the teacher doesn't have free slots. Please choose another
About myself
Sveiki! Mani sauc Sinazo. Esmu harizmātisks un uzticams skolotājs kopš 2019. gada. Esmu apņēmies nodrošināt studentus ar nepieciešamajiem instrumentiem, lai sasniegtu akadēmiskos mērķus un palīdzētu v...
Learn moreLearn more Sinazo
Lessons taught 6779
teacher avatar

Gold B

map markerPhilippines
user languageNear-native
thumb up496 positive feedbacks
students
lessons
Sorry, the teacher doesn't have free slots. Please choose another
Sorry, the teacher doesn't have free slots. Please choose another
About myself
Hello! My name is Gold B. I have been teaching English since 2022. I have taught students of different nationalities, ages, and levels. My passion is to create a positive and supportive environment, b...
Learn moreLearn more Gold B
Lessons taught 2116
teacher avatar

Teboho

map markerSouth Africa
user languageNative speaker
thumb up496 positive feedbacks
students34 active students
lessons
Sorry, the teacher doesn't have free slots. Please choose another
Sorry, the teacher doesn't have free slots. Please choose another
About myself
Hi, I'm Teboho. I have been teaching English since 2022. I have experience teaching students from all age groups in all parts of the word. My classrooms are student centered and filled with energy. My...
Learn moreLearn more Teboho
Lessons taught 2730
teacher avatar

Jaybe L

map markerPhilippines
user languageNear-native
thumb up496 positive feedbacks
students142 active students
lessons3622 lessons
Sorry, the teacher doesn't have free slots. Please choose another
Sorry, the teacher doesn't have free slots. Please choose another
About myself
Hello! My name is Jaybe L. I have been teaching English since 2017. I can teach students from kids to adults and beginners to advanced. Learning the language can be fun and easy. In my style of teachi...
Learn moreLearn more Jaybe L
Lessons taught 3622
teacher avatar

Grace

map markerPhilippines
user languageNear-native
thumb up495 positive feedbacks
students33 active students
lessons4351 lesson
Sorry, the teacher doesn't have free slots. Please choose another
Sorry, the teacher doesn't have free slots. Please choose another
About myself
Sveiki! Es esmu Greisa! Un es mācu angļu valodu kopš 2015. Es esmu mācījis dažādu vecumu un līmeņu studentus. Es neticami aizraujos ar mācīt un palīdzēt saviem skolēniem sasniegt savus mērķus jautrā u...
Learn moreLearn more Grace
Lessons taught 4351
teacher avatar

April Du

map markerPhilippines
user languageNear-native
thumb up495 positive feedbacks
students56 active students
lessons2099 lessons
Sorry, the teacher doesn't have free slots. Please choose another
Sorry, the teacher doesn't have free slots. Please choose another
About myself
Hi! My name is April Du. I've been teaching English as a second language since 2019. I have taught students online aged 4 to 60 from beginners to advance. My teaching style is interactive and student ...
Learn moreLearn more April Du
Lessons taught 2099
teacher avatar

Merry A

map markerPhilippines
user languageNear-native
thumb up493 positive feedbacks
students79 active students
lessons1791 lesson
Sorry, the teacher doesn't have free slots. Please choose another
Sorry, the teacher doesn't have free slots. Please choose another
About myself
Hello, there! My name is Merry A, and I am thrilled to be your teacher. I have been teaching foreign students since 2021. I am deeply passionate about teaching and helping my students achieve their go...
Learn moreLearn more Merry A
Lessons taught 1791
teacher avatar

Yani

map markerPhilippines
user languageNear-native
thumb up492 positive feedbacks
students54 active students
lessons4601 lesson
Sorry, the teacher doesn't have free slots. Please choose another
Sorry, the teacher doesn't have free slots. Please choose another
About myself
Sveiki! Es esmu Yani! Es mācu kopš 2001. gada. Es aizraujos ar mācīšanu. Es savas nodarbības padaru interesantas, izmantojot kartītes un rekvizītus. Specializējos bērnudārzā līdz vidusskolai. Manā kla...
Learn moreLearn more Yani
Lessons taught 4601
teacher avatar

Hannah S

map markerPhilippines
user languageNear-native
thumb up492 positive feedbacks
students84 active students
lessons2845 lessons
Sorry, the teacher doesn't have free slots. Please choose another
Sorry, the teacher doesn't have free slots. Please choose another
About myself
Hello! I’m Hannah S, an enthusiastic ESL teacher. I’ve been teaching English as a private tutor since 2021. I work with students of all levels, from beginners to advanced learners, and I’m here to hel...
Learn moreLearn more Hannah S
Lessons taught 2845
teacher avatar

Audrey B

map markerPhilippines
user languageNear-native
thumb up492 positive feedbacks
students56 active students
lessons2249 lessons
Sorry, the teacher doesn't have free slots. Please choose another
Sorry, the teacher doesn't have free slots. Please choose another
About myself
Hi! I'm Audrey B, and I’ve been teaching since 2016 in both classroom and online settings. My teaching style is inquiry-based, which means I encourage students to ask questions and think critically, m...
Learn moreLearn more Audrey B
Lessons taught 2249
teacher avatar

Dolly

map markerNigeria
user languageNear-native
thumb up492 positive feedbacks
students93 active students
lessons
Sorry, the teacher doesn't have free slots. Please choose another
Sorry, the teacher doesn't have free slots. Please choose another
Lessons taught 3715
teacher avatar

Roseline

map markerNigeria
user languageNear-native
thumb up491 positive feedback
students69 active students
lessons2223 lessons
Sorry, the teacher doesn't have free slots. Please choose another
Sorry, the teacher doesn't have free slots. Please choose another
About myself
Hello! My name is Roseline! I’ve been teaching diverse learners across different ages and levels since 2014, and I have developed a passion to assist any student who strives for success while learning...
Learn moreLearn more Roseline
Lessons taught 2223
teacher avatar

Marj

map markerPhilippines
user languageNear-native
thumb up
students
lessons1655 lessons
Sorry, the teacher doesn't have free slots. Please choose another
Sorry, the teacher doesn't have free slots. Please choose another
About myself
Hello! I'm Marj, and I've been teaching since 2020. I've had the pleasure of teaching students from all walks of life, ranging from children to adults, as well as corporate clients with varied skill l...
Learn moreLearn more Marj
Lessons taught 1655
teacher avatar

June A

map markerPhilippines
user languageNear-native
thumb up
students69 active students
lessons3769 lessons
Sorry, the teacher doesn't have free slots. Please choose another
Sorry, the teacher doesn't have free slots. Please choose another
Lessons taught 3769
teacher avatar

Rosie O

map markerPhilippines
user languageNear-native
thumb up489 positive feedbacks
students84 active students
lessons2841 lesson
Sorry, the teacher doesn't have free slots. Please choose another
Sorry, the teacher doesn't have free slots. Please choose another
About myself
Hi! I’m Rosie O, a licensed teacher, and I’ve been practicing my profession for over a decade. My experience makes me equipped to teach students at various levels. It is my task to understand the need...
Learn moreLearn more Rosie O
Lessons taught 2841
teacher avatar

Kheya

map markerPhilippines
user languageNear-native
thumb up489 positive feedbacks
students65 active students
lessons2542 lessons
Sorry, the teacher doesn't have free slots. Please choose another
Sorry, the teacher doesn't have free slots. Please choose another
About myself
Hi! I'm Kheya, I been working as an online English teacher since March 2022. My hobbies are reading books and doing puzzles, which helps me grow significantly as an educator. Reading helps me stay cur...
Learn moreLearn more Kheya
Lessons taught 2542
teacher avatar

Nileh S

map markerSouth Africa
user languageNear-native
thumb up489 positive feedbacks
students67 active students
lessons2037 lessons
Sorry, the teacher doesn't have free slots. Please choose another
Sorry, the teacher doesn't have free slots. Please choose another
About myself
Hi! I'm Nileh S! I have been teaching English since 2022 and have worked with students of different ages from all over the world. I enjoy sharing knowledge with others and seeing them succeed. My teac...
Learn moreLearn more Nileh S
Lessons taught 2037
teacher avatar

Sue D

map markerSouth Africa
user languageNative speaker
thumb up488 positive feedbacks
students65 active students
lessons1353 lessons
Sorry, the teacher doesn't have free slots. Please choose another
Sorry, the teacher doesn't have free slots. Please choose another
About myself
Hello! My name is Sue D! I am a teacher with a passion for helping students achieve their English language goals. With experience teaching English to students of all ages and levels, I possess a stron...
Learn moreLearn more Sue D
Lessons taught 1353
teacher avatar

Kistine M

map markerPhilippines
user languageNear-native
thumb up487 positive feedbacks
students108 active students
lessons1985 lessons
Sorry, the teacher doesn't have free slots. Please choose another
Sorry, the teacher doesn't have free slots. Please choose another
About myself
Hi! I'm Kristine M! I have been teaching English since 2022. I have worked with learners from diverse cultural backgrounds. I am a dedicated teacher who's passionate about creating a welcoming and a...
Learn moreLearn more Kistine M
Lessons taught 1985
teacher avatar

Hazel Ro

map markerPhilippines
user languageNear-native
thumb up487 positive feedbacks
students79 active students
lessons3748 lessons
Sorry, the teacher doesn't have free slots. Please choose another
Sorry, the teacher doesn't have free slots. Please choose another
About myself
Sveiki! Es esmu Hazela! Es mācu tiešsaistē kopš 2019. gada un esmu apkalpojis skolēnus, sākot no trīsgadīgiem bērniem līdz pieaugušajiem. Turklāt divus gadus pēc kārtas mācīju pamatskolā, kur vadīju d...
Learn moreLearn more Hazel Ro
Lessons taught 3748